Document Description
The California Department of Fish and Wildlife (CDFW) has executed Streambed Alteration Agreement number 1600--2019-0013-R6, pursuant to section 1602 of the Fish and Game Code to the project Applicant; California Department of Transportation. The project is limited to the removal and replacement of four existing culverts at the locations described above. Project implementation will result in temporary disturbance to 0.22 acre of Fish and Game Code section 1502 resources.

Other Location Info
The project includes drainages at Post-Mile (PM) 15.09, 15.35, 15.40, and 15.55 that are located along State Route 38 In the San Bernardino National Forest, approximately 2 miles west of Forest Falls, San Bernardino County
